Kimberly Mann

Artist & Author

I make sense of the world and communicate through art, utilizing any medium that inspires me. I completed my Masters in Art at the University of Guam while exploring the use of books as a medium, but have also been drawn to gold leaf, mixed media, photography, and most recently, woodworking. In 2015 I was diagnosed with PTSD, which has forever changed my life, and my art. I am committed to creating art that portrays the light and hope of healing and pray that my pieces encourage others along their own path of healing.

 

I’ve also published the book, Living and Creating with PTSD. This is a first-hand account of living with Post-Traumatic Stress Disorder from the unique perspective of an artist. As you thumb through the pages of my gallery, my artwork tells the story of PTSD: what it is, who it affects, the pain that it brings, and the healing that is possible.
